@@ -1130,6 +1130,15 @@ python emit_pkgdata() {
      workdir = d.getVar('WORKDIR', True)

      for pkg in packages.split():
+        items = {}
+        for files_list in pkgfiles[pkg]:
+             item_name = os.path.basename(files_list)
+             item_path = files_list.split(os.path.basename(files_list))[0]
[:-1]

There is os.path.dirname() for this as well; alternatively you could use
os.path.split() to get both at the same time.

+             if item_path not in items:
+                 items[item_path] = []
+                 items[item_path].append(item_name)
+             else:
+                 items[item_path].append(item_name)
This could be simplified to:
              if item_path not in items:
                  items[item_path] = []
              items[item_path].append(item_name)
